[ARCHIVED] Shore Shooters 4-H Club to Hold Open House

Shore Shorters Photo

The Cape May County 4-H Shore Shooters Club will be holding an open house on Sunday, February 28 at 5p.m. at Fletcher’s Corner Archery Range, 212 S. Delsea Drive, Cape May Court House, New Jersey. There will be food, games, prizes and of course Archery at the Open House.

Christine Holly, one of the leaders of the 4-H club, encourages anyone in 4th grade through one year out of high school to come learn more about Shore Shooters at the Open House. “Learning archery builds confidence and strength in a young person,” she says. “And, being a part of 4-H gives you the opportunity to make new friends and learn leadership skills.”

No experience or equipment are needed. Whether you are an advanced archer or you just want to give it a try, there is a place for you in the Shore Shooters 4-H Club.

The 4-H Youth Development Program is part of the New Jersey Agricultural Experiment Station and Rutgers Cooperative Extension. 4-H educational programs are offered to all youth grades K – 13 on an age-appropriate basis, without regard to race, religion, color, natural origin, gender, sexual orientation or disability.
